Impact of Extreme Temperatures on Car Performance
The scorching heat of Dubai, with summer temperatures often exceeding 40°C (104°F), can have a profound impact on various components of a car. One of the most immediate effects is on the vehicle’s cooling system. The engine generates a significant amount of heat, and in such high ambient temperatures, the cooling system must work overtime to prevent overheating. This can lead to increased wear and tear on components such as the radiator, water pump, and hoses.
Moreover, the heat can affect the car’s battery life. High temperatures can cause the battery fluid to evaporate, leading to reduced battery life and performance. This is why many car owners in Dubai find themselves replacing their batteries more frequently than in cooler climates. Additionally, the heat can cause the air conditioning system to work harder, which not only affects fuel efficiency but also puts additional strain on the engine.
Tire performance is another area affected by the extreme heat. The high temperatures can cause the air inside the tires to expand, leading to increased tire pressure. This can result in a higher risk of blowouts, especially if the tires are not properly maintained. Regular checks and adjustments of tire pressure are crucial to ensure safety and optimal performance.
Effects of Sandstorms and Dust on Vehicles
Sandstorms are a common occurrence in Dubai, and they can wreak havoc on vehicles. The fine sand particles can infiltrate various parts of the car, including the engine, air filters, and interior. This can lead to clogged filters, reduced engine efficiency, and potential damage to the paintwork and body of the car.
To combat the effects of sandstorms, regular maintenance is essential. This includes frequent cleaning and replacement of air filters, as well as regular washing of the car to remove sand and dust particles. Protective coatings and waxes can also be applied to the car’s exterior to help shield the paint from abrasive sand particles.
Furthermore, sand can accumulate in the braking system, leading to reduced braking efficiency and increased wear on brake pads and discs. Regular inspection and maintenance of the braking system are vital to ensure safety and performance.
Humidity and Its Impact on Car Components
While Dubai is predominantly dry, the humidity levels can rise significantly, especially during the cooler months. High humidity can lead to condensation in various parts of the car, including the fuel tank and electrical systems. This can cause corrosion and rust, which can compromise the integrity and functionality of these components.
To mitigate the effects of humidity, it is important to keep the car in a well-ventilated area and to use anti-corrosion sprays and treatments on vulnerable parts. Regular checks of the electrical system and fuel lines can help identify and address any issues before they become serious problems.
